Warning Signs You Need Hotel Damage Restoration

Catching damage early is vital. Ignoring subtle signs can turn minor issues into major, costly repairs. Our team is trained to spot potential problems that others might miss, saving you time and money in the long run. Keep an eye out for these indicators.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

A persistent musty or moldy smell, especially in specific rooms or common areas, is a strong indicator of hidden moisture. This often means mold is starting to grow behind walls or under flooring, requiring immediate professional attention.

Visible Water Stains or Discoloration

Any new or spreading water stains on ceilings, walls, or floors are clear signs of a leak or past water intrusion. These marks aren’t just cosmetic; they signal that the underlying materials are compromised and need thorough drying and repair.

Peeling or Bubbling Paint/Wallpaper

When paint or wallpaper starts to peel, blister, or warp, it’s usually due to moisture trapped behind it. This is a common sign of water damage that has gone unnoticed or untreated, compromising the integrity of your surfaces.

Soft or Spongy Flooring

If carpets feel unusually damp, or if hard flooring like tile or laminate feels soft or spongy underfoot, it means there’s moisture trapped beneath. This can lead to serious structural damage and mold growth if not addressed promptly with specialized drying equipment.

Warped Door Frames or Trim

Doors that stick or don’t close properly, or trim that appears warped or separated from the wall, often indicate that the wood has absorbed moisture and expanded. This is a sign of significant water intrusion that needs expert assessment and remediation.

Electrical Issues or Flickering Lights

Any unusual electrical problems, such as flickering lights, tripped breakers, or the smell of burning from outlets, can be a dangerous consequence of water damage. Water and electricity are a hazardous mix, so such signs require immediate professional inspection.

Hotel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Minor, isolated spill on a non-carpeted floor Yes No Easy to wipe up and dry with basic tools.
Small patch of surface mold on a bathroom tile Maybe Yes Requires proper PPE and mold-killing solutions; easy to spread spores if not handled correctly.
Burst pipe causing flooding in a guest room No Yes Needs immediate, large-scale water extraction and drying equipment to prevent long-term damage.
Mildew smell in a small linen closet Maybe Yes Could be a sign of hidden moisture requiring specialized detection and drying.
Storm damage causing roof leaks and ceiling water stains No Yes Involves structural integrity, potential electrical hazards, and extensive drying needs.
Clogged toilet overflow in a single bathroom Maybe Yes Can spread contaminants and require specialized sanitization and drying.

While small spills might be manageable with basic supplies, most hotel damage situations require professional intervention. The complexity of hotel environments, guest safety, and the need for rapid turnaround means that calling a pro is often the most efficient and effective choice.

Hotel Damage Restoration Cost In Cedar Hill, TX

The cost of Hotel Damage Restoration in Cedar Hill, TX can vary significantly. Factors such as the size of the affected area, the type of damage (water, fire, mold), the extent of the structural impact, and the speed of response all play a role. These figures are estimates to give you an idea of what to expect.

Service Aspect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Emergency Water Extraction $500 – $3,000 Volume of water, accessibility, and urgency of response.
Structural Drying & Dehumidification $750 – $4,000 Size of the affected area, humidity levels, and duration of drying needed.
Mold Remediation (small areas) $1,000 – $5,000 Severity of mold growth, containment needs, and specific treatment methods.
Carpet & Upholstery Cleaning/Restoration $300 – $1,500 Square footage, type of material, and degree of soiling or damage.
Minor Drywall & Plaster Repair $400 – $2,000 Amount of material needed, complexity of the repair, and finishing requirements.
Odor Removal $300 – $1,200 Type of odor, size of the space, and the technology used for neutralization.

How do you prevent mold after water damage in a hotel?

Preventing mold is a critical part of our process. We use advanced drying techniques with high-velocity air movers and industrial dehumidifiers to reduce moisture levels below 16%. Thorough cleaning and sanitization of affected materials also help inhibit mold growth, ensuring a healthy indoor environment for your guests.

What specialized equipment do you use for hotel water damage?

We utilize a range of specialized equipment, including truck-mounted and portable water extraction units, various types of dehumidifiers (LGR, desiccant), air scrubbers with HEPA filters, thermal imaging cameras for detecting hidden moisture, and industrial-strength air movers. This advanced technology allows us to dry and restore your property effectively and efficiently, minimizing disruption to your operations.
